Cotton Classic held at FA
by Joey Martin - posted E-mail Story E-mail Story | Print Story Print Story 
Franklin Academy's boys split a pair of games at the Cotton Classic last week.

The Cougars lost to Tallulah before defeating Union in the final game of the tournament.

"We looked real good," said Franklin Academy boys coach Tommy Kimbrough. "We've only got seven kids, but I would rather have these seven because they play hard all the time and give everything they have every time they hit the floor. They are winners no matter what happens on the court."

Franklin's girls dropped its games to Tensas and Tallulah.

Franklin hosts Tallulah today (Tuesday) in four games.
